Can you explain what a mental capacity assessment is?


A mental capacity assessment looks at a person’s ability to make specific decisions, based on the legal criteria set out in the Mental Capacity Act 2005. When it comes to making a will, the assessment follows the principles established in the case of Banks v Goodfellow. When making a gift, the legal test is that from Re. Beaney.
